Transaction 3391676a61962bc5f026f419e50b69b6769043af43434c38171ac8dbb021b901
1 Input
2 Outputs
- 3391676a61962bc5f026f419e50b69b6769043af43434c38171ac8dbb021b901:0
- 3391676a61962bc5f026f419e50b69b6769043af43434c38171ac8dbb021b901:1
value 92240000
address 1BvEZyNVih7mtww33743duVmz37XMYQ5tX
value 19110000
address 1De5eUaPH1CZ5fAafbx9k7Kc8mPX8ogMVx